Hello All,
We are trying to find a way to pull off and save Blue Print files from an Apple Configurator 2 workstation so we can keep copies on multiple macs. Has anyone figured out a way to do this? Any help much appreciated.
@agomes Blueprints are .plists and can be exported/imported by moving files from/to ~/Library/Group Containers/Group.com.apple.configurator/Library/Application Support/com.apple.configurator/Blueprints
You might need to make that folder on a computer running Configurator that doesn't have any Blueprints.

Once the blueprints are moved to that location, how can I access them in Configurator 2? When i try to apply a blueprint to a device, none show up.
Solved! The blueprints showed up in Configurator 2 after I rebooted the computer.

Saw this post and found that AC2 blue are located here now: ~/Library/Group Containers/K36BKF7T3D.group.com.apple.configurator/Library/Application Support/com.apple.configurator/Blueprints/
